Just Clean Brake Fluid is Essential for Safe Driving

Clean brake fluid is the cornerstone of your vehicle's braking system. , As vehicles age brake fluid absorbs moisture from the atmosphere. This impurity reduces its effectiveness, causing a decrease in your braking performance. When brakes aren't working properly, it can result dangerous situations on the streets. Regular brake fluid replacement ensures optimal safety, providing you peace of mind and a safer driving experience.

Safeguarding Your Safety: Identifying and Preventing Moisture in Brake Fluid

Moisture within brake fluid may be a critical threat to your safety. Over time, moisture penetrates into the brake system, diminishing its effectiveness and amplifying your risk of an accident.
